Denis Wick DW5880-5BS Silver-Plated Medium Bore Trombone Mouthpiece is crafted for players who demand a balanced, expressive core tone with dependable response across ensembles. The silver-plated finish adds brightness and carrying power, helping your notes project without forcing the air. Built around precise dimensions, this mouthpiece is a versatile platform for a range of repertoire and playing styles.

  • Cup diameter: 25.73 mm
  • Rim width: 6.64 mm
  • Bore size: 6.87 mm
  • Backbore: Medium
  • Finish: Silver-plated
  • Part number: DW5880-5BS
  • Release date: 2010
  • Condition: New

This mouthpiece shines in situations where players need reliable articulation and a consistent feel. The 25.73 mm cup diameter offers a balanced depth that supports clean attack and controlled airflow, while the 6.64 mm rim width provides a comfortable embouchure contact that can sustain long practice sessions without fatigue. The 6.87 mm bore, paired with a medium backbore, delivers a measured amount of resistance—enabling precise intonation and a focused core tone without sacrificing ease of high-register slurs or quick attacks.
